William Turner Obituary

William F. Turner 1950 ~ 2007 LAYTON - Bill Turner, 56, passed away Wednesday, Feb. 7, 2007. He was born September 5, 1950 in Los Angeles, CA the son of Melvin "Bill" and Charlene Marshall Turner. He married Pamela K. McKellar on May 6, 1978 in Inglewood, CA. Bill was not involved in organized religion, but had a very deep sincere, childlike faith in the one true and Living God. Bill was a loyal and devoted husband and father. A man who set a great example of love, by doing whatever was needed to provide for those he loved, even when that meant he had to go without. He had a sense of humor that was unquenchable, even up until his last few days. Bill was a gentle private man who was fair and loving, his discipline in prayer for others in need was what defined him as the man he became until his death. We, as his family know the only way he could be more intimate with the Father, was to be in His presence. Surviving are his wife Pam Turner, son, Brett Turner, London, England; daughter Chelsey (Jeff) Benson, San Diego, CA; daughter Naomi Turner, Tucson, AZ; sister Cindy Gannon, CA; nieces and nephew, Trevor (Lisa), Debbie (Tom), Kim (Johnny), all of California. Funeral services will be held Saturday, February 10, 2007 at 11 a.m. at Lindquist's Layton Mortuary, 1867 No. Fairfield Road. No public viewing will be held. Interment, Lindquist's Memorial Park at Layton, 1867 No. Fairfield Road.
